Rev. James (Jim) Ural Richmond, 74, of Jonesboro passed from this life on Tuesday, March 16, 2021. He was born to the late Ural and Elizabeth Richmond on September 3, 1946 in Saffell, Arkansas. Jim has lived in the Jonesboro area since 1973 serving as a Pentecostal preacher for over 40 years. He owned and operated Richmond Building in Jonesboro for many years. He then worked as a supervisor for Vance/Nabholz Construction until retirement. Jim enjoyed gardening, building, and spending time with his grandchildren.
